This award recognises the outstanding achievements of Australia-based ADC–ICC Asia-Pacific Commercial Mediation Competition (APCMC) teams, who demonstrate excellence in integrating ADR processes within their academic studies, university extracurriculars, and community endeavours beyond the competition itself. It is open to all Australia-based teams who competed in APCMC 2025.

Criteria: Submissions will be judged on responses to the following:

  1. Excluding your APCMC participation, outline your study, research, and activities over the past 12 months that demonstrate excellence in academia, university extracurriculars, and community endeavours in the area of ADR.
  2. Detail the specific skills you used to achieve the above and explain how you adapted your approach and ADR processes to engage effectively with different ADR related activities?
  3. How do your ADR related studies and activities contribute to your learning objectives and prepare you to meet the specific needs of future clients in a practical and impactful way?
